excel使用的是什么编程语言
-
Excel使用的编程语言是Visual Basic for Applications(VBA)。
VBA是一种基于事件驱动的编程语言,它是Microsoft Office套件的一部分,主要用于自定义和自动化办公任务。在Excel中,用户可以通过编写VBA代码来操作、修改和扩展Excel的功能。
VBA具有以下特点:
- 简单易学:VBA采用了与Visual Basic类似的语法,所以对于了解VB或其他编程语言的开发人员而言很容易上手。
- 操作Excel:VBA可以直接操作Excel的对象模型,通过对工作簿、工作表、单元格等对象进行操作,实现数据的读取、写入、格式化以及图表的生成等功能。
- 宏录制:Excel还提供了宏录制功能,允许用户按照自己的操作步骤记录宏,然后将其转换为VBA代码,方便以后的重复使用和修改。
- 与其他Office应用程序的集成:VBA不仅可以用于Excel,还可以应用于其他Office应用程序,如Word、PowerPoint等,实现不同应用程序之间的数据交互和操作。
- 丰富的函数库:VBA提供了丰富的内置函数库,包括数学、日期、字符串等常用函数,开发人员可以直接调用这些函数来简化开发过程。
总之,通过VBA编程,用户可以在Excel中实现更复杂的功能和自动化任务,提高工作效率,并根据自己的需求进行定制化操作。
1年前 -
Excel使用的是一种名为Visual Basic for Applications(VBA)的编程语言。以下是关于Excel使用VBA的一些重要信息:
-
VBA是一种基于事件驱动编程的语言。它允许用户编写自定义的宏和脚本来自动化各种Excel任务,例如数据处理、报表生成和图表制作等。
-
VBA只能在Excel中使用。它与Excel紧密集成,可以直接访问Excel的对象模型以及各种功能和属性。通过VBA,用户可以以编程的方式控制和操作Excel的各个方面。
-
VBA采用类似于其他基于对象的编程语言的语法。它支持变量、条件语句、循环语句、函数和过程等基本编程结构。用户可以通过编写VBA代码来定义变量、执行计算、控制流程、调用其他函数等。
-
Excel提供了一个内置的VBA编辑器,用户可以在其中编写和编辑VBA代码。编辑器具有代码窗口、调试窗口、自动完成、语法检查和代码注释等功能,方便用户进行代码开发和调试。
-
VBA可以通过记录宏来学习和生成代码。在Excel中,用户可以使用“开发者”选项卡下的“录制宏”功能来录制他们在Excel中执行的一系列操作,然后将其保存为VBA代码。通过查看生成的VBA代码,用户可以学习如何使用VBA来执行相似的任务。
1年前 -
-
Excel使用的是一种名为Visual Basic for Applications(VBA)的编程语言。VBA是基于Microsoft Visual Basic的宏语言,专门用于编写和执行在Excel电子表格中自动化任务的脚本。
VBA与其他编程语言相似,具有变量、运算符、条件语句、循环语句和函数等基本语法。通过编写VBA代码,用户可以自定义功能、处理数据和自动执行各种操作,从而增强Excel的功能。
下面将详细介绍如何使用VBA编程来利用Excel进行自动化任务。
一、打开VBA编辑器
在Excel中,可以通过按下Alt+F11快捷键来打开VBA编辑器。在编辑器中,可以看到VBA的代码窗口、项目资源管理器、属性窗口等。二、编写VBA代码
在VBA编辑器的代码窗口中,可以编写VBA代码。例如,可以编写一个简单的代码来在工作表的A1单元格中显示“Hello, World!”:Sub HelloWorld() Range("A1").Value = "Hello, World!" End Sub这个代码会将字符串“Hello, World!”写入到工作表的A1单元格中。
三、运行VBA代码
有多种方法来运行VBA代码。一种方法是通过按下F5键或点击VBA编辑器的【运行】按钮来执行代码。另一种方法是将代码与Excel电子表格中的按钮或其他事件关联起来,当用户点击按钮或发生特定事件时,自动触发代码的执行。四、自定义功能和处理数据
VBA可以用于创建自定义函数、过滤和排序数据、进行数学运算、处理日期和时间等。通过编写VBA代码,可以根据具体需求来实现各种功能。例如,可以编写一个代码来计算两个单元格之和:Function AddTwoCells(ByVal cell1 As Range, ByVal cell2 As Range) As Variant AddTwoCells = cell1.Value + cell2.Value End Function这个代码定义了一个名为AddTwoCells的函数,接受两个单元格作为输入,返回它们的和。
五、自动化操作
VBA还可以用于自动化各种操作,例如创建和格式化工作表、插入图表、合并和拆分单元格、筛选和排序数据等。通过编写VBA代码,可以自动执行这些操作,提高工作效率。六、调试和错误处理
在编写VBA代码时,可能会出现错误。VBA提供了调试工具,可以帮助用户查找和修复错误。可以使用断点、单步执行、观察窗口等功能来跟踪代码的执行并检查变量的值。此外,VBA还提供了错误处理机制,用户可以在代码中添加错误处理程序,以便在发生错误时执行特定的操作。
总结:
Excel使用的编程语言是Visual Basic for Applications(VBA)。通过编写和执行VBA代码,可以实现Excel的自动化任务、自定义功能和处理数据等操作。使用VBA可以帮助用户提高工作效率,并对Excel进行更多的定制和扩展。1年前